Fellow Real Estate Investors,

Down here I want to layout my first deal. This deal takes place in Spain (However, I am not able to select that location). I am originally from the Netherlands. I started my Real Estate investing journey 8 months ago and I have obtained 4 properties by now. Of the 4, I want to discuss the numbers of my first deal here. I am trying to become specialized in achieving the highest possible CoC-Return. All suggestions, ideas and comments are very welcome:

Property Information - Financially
Purchase Price€93.000
Purchase Closing Costs€13.950
Estimated Repair Costs€35.000
Pre-Rent Colding Costs€1.280
Total Costs of Project€143.230
After Repair Value€ 150.000
Down Payment (Own Cash)€87.830
Loan Amount€55.400
Loan Fees€1.200
Loan Interest Rate4,04%
Period Loan180 months
Property Information - Financially
MONTHLY INCOME€2.400TOTAL CASH NEEDED€87.830
MONTHLY EXPENSES€1.346,65COC ROI14,39%
MONTHY CASH FLOW€1.053,35TOTAL ROI30,61%


The following categories have been included in the section "Monthly Expenses": Vacancy 5%, Taxes, Repairs 10%, CapEx, Internet, Insurance, Property Taxes, mortgage and interest. I even have a double financing on this property, otherwise my net CF per month would have been significant higher. Management fee is excluded, as I do management and tenant searching/screening myself.
